Hey — handing off the Murrow Hall audio-guide app before my leave. The tour-sync branch is ready for review; main gotcha is the offline cache invalidation in ExhibitLoader. If the signing service locks you out while testing releases, you'll need the recovery passphrase to reset it. Keeping it here so review isn't blocked; it's the line below.

recovery phrase for faduf-hawep: casix-gilox

The Farelab ticket-pricing experiment service rejected last night's config push with a signature mismatch, so the new fare variants never went live and all venues fell back to baseline pricing. Root cause: the config was signed with the retired staging key after last week's rotation. No customer-facing pricing errors occurred. Support should tell experimenters to re-sign configs with the current key and resubmit; pushes verified against it deploy normally. The active verification key is below.

release key, bahof-hafog: bky3_ztf

## AgriLink Gateway — Restart Procedure

When the AgriLink telemetry gateway stops forwarding tractor sensor data, drain the ingest queue, restart the collector service, and confirm heartbeat messages resume within two minutes. Backfilled readings are deduplicated downstream, so replays are safe. Note restarts in the sync doc. The collector writes telemetry batches to the readings database using the connection string below.

replica DSN, kajep-yahag: mssql://praok_svc:iF@db-8d68.plorvaio.local:5432/eliion